The Wet Vacuum Water Extraction Process: A Step-by-Step Guide

At our company, we understand that every water damage situation is unique. That’s why we take a customized approach to Wet Vacuum Water Extraction. Our process involves several key steps:

Initial Assessment

We’ll inspect your property to find out the source and extent of the water damage. This includes identifying areas where water may have seeped into walls, floors, and ceilings. Our team will also check for signs of mold, mildew, or other secondary damage.

Extraction and Removal

We’ll use our truck-mounted vacuum equipment to remove standing water and moisture from your property. This includes wet carpets, pad, and flooring, as well as walls and ceilings.

Dehumidification and Drying

We’ll use specialized equipment to remove excess moisture from the air and speed up the drying process. This includes dehumidifiers, air movers, and other tools to help dry out your property.

Disinfecting and Sanitizing

We’ll disinfect and sanitize your property to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. This includes using antimicrobial solutions to remove bacteria, viruses, and other microorganisms.

Final Inspection and Cleanup

We’ll inspect your property one last time to ensure that all water damage has been removed and your property is safe and dry. This includes cleaning up any remaining debris and checking for any signs of further damage.

Warning Signs You Need Wet Vacuum Water Extraction

Ignoring warning signs can lead to bigger problems down the road. Here are some common signs that you may need Wet Vacuum Water Extraction services: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a musty smell that persists even after cleaning and air freshening, it may be a sign that there’s moisture hidden in your walls or ceilings. Don’t ignore it, call us right away to inspect and extract any standing water.

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ings

If you see water stains on your walls or ceilings, it’s a sign that water has seeped into the drywall. Don’t wait, call us to inspect and extract any standing water.

Buckled or Warped Flooring

If your flooring is buckled or warped, it may be a sign that water has damaged the underlying wood or subfloor. Don’t wait, call us to inspect and extract any standing water.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

If your paint or wallpaper is peeling, it may be a sign that water has damaged the underlying surface. Don’t wait, call us to inspect and extract any standing water.

Cracked or Broken Drywall

If your drywall is cracked or broken, it may be a sign that water has damaged the underlying surface. Don’t wait, call us to inspect and extract any standing water.

Mold or Mildew Growth

If you notice mold or mildew growth on your walls, ceilings, or floors, it’s a sign that there’s excess moisture in the air. Don’t ignore it, call us right away to inspect and extract any standing water.

Wet Vacuum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ill Yes, DIY is fine No, not necessary You can clean up a small water spill on your own with a mop and towels.
Large water damage No, don’t try to DIY Yes, call a pro Large water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to remove standing water and prevent further damage.
Hidden water damage No, don’t try to DIY Yes, call a pro Hidden water damage can be difficult to detect and needs specialized equipment to locate and extract any standing water.
Mold or mildew growth No, don’t try to DIY Yes, call a pro Mold and mildew growth can be toxic and need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ely remove and prevent further growth.
High-risk areas (e.g., commercial or industrial properties) No, don’t try to DIY Yes, call a pro High-risk areas need specialized equipment and expertise to safely remove standing water and prevent further damage.
Emergency situations (e.g., burst pipes or flooding) No, don’t try to DIY Yes, call a pro Emergency situations need immediate attention and specialized equipment to safely remove standing water and prevent further damage.

Wet Vacuum Water Extraction Cost in Castle Rock, CO

The cost of Wet Vacuum Water Extraction services varies depending on the severity and size of the affected area. In Castle Rock, CO, pr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Extraction $500 – $1,500 Size and severity of damage, number of affected areas
Dehumidification and Drying $200 – $1,000 Size and severity of damage, number of affected areas
Disinfecting and Sanitizing $100 – $500 Size and severity of damage, number of affected areas
Final Inspection and Cleanup $100 – $500 Size and severity of damage, number of affected areas
More Equipment and Labor $500 – $2,000 Size and severity of damage, number of affected areas
Emergency Services (e.g., burst pipes or flooding) $1,000 – $5,000 Severity and size of damage, number of affected areas

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and inspection of your property. We offer free estimates and will work with you to create a customized plan to meet your needs and budget.

Common Questions About Wet Vacuum Water Extraction

Q: What is Wet Vacuum Water Extraction?

Wet Vacuum Water Extraction is a process used to remove standing water and moisture from a property after a flood or water damage event. It’s a critical step in preventing further damage and restoring your property to its former glory.

Q: Why is it so important to act fast after a water damage event?

Acting quickly is crucial in preventing further damage and saving you money on repairs. The longer you wait, the more damage can spread, and the higher the repair costs will be.

Q: What are the benefits of professional Wet Vacuum Water Extraction services?

Professional Wet Vacuum Water Extraction services offer many benefits, including faster drying times, reduced repair costs, and a safer, healthier environment for you and your family.

Q: How long does the Wet Vacuum Water Extraction process take?

The length of time it takes to complete the Wet Vacuum Water Extraction process varies depending on the size and severity of the affected area. But, in most cases, we can complete the process within 3-5 days.

Q: Is Wet Vacuum Water Extraction covered by insurance?

Wet Vacuum Water Extraction services may be covered by your insurance policy, depending on the type of damage and the terms of your policy. It’s always best to check with your insurance provider to find out what’s covered and what’s not.
